“I have Social Anxiety Disorder.”

Doing an inquiry on the concept: “I have Social Anxiety Disorder.” The four questions. 1 Is it true? 2 Can you REALLY know that it is true? 3 How do you react, what happens to you when you believe the thought? 4 Who would you be without the thought? Turn the thought around. “I have Social Anxiety Disorder,” turned around: I don’t have Social Anxiety Disorder. (How could that possibly be as true, or truer?) *There are times when I have experienced social situations with no anxiety at all, or only a little anxiety. *”Social Anxiety Disorder,” SAD is a label that a psychologist *created* to make it easy for diagnosis & treatment *Some of the anxieties we experience have nothing to do with socializing, ie my family’s health, money *SAD can be broken down into individual concepts, ie “I am not good enough,” “I am a failure..” And the good news is that concepts can be questioned! *Actually, the fears that we have are universal beliefs – do we have a DISORDER, are we mentally ILL? Or is it possible that we just attach to our concepts more heavily than others (and can we even know that THAT is true)? How could it possibly be as true or truer, for you, that maybe.. you don’t have a disorder? ** Note: And just because I don’t believe I have SAD anymore, does not mean I can’t continue to use CBT, seek help, join support groups, etc. PLEASEEE do not take this video as me minimizing the amount of suffering you are experiencing, or that I’m saying you shouldn’t seek treatment! www
